Short-term rentals (STRs)—typically defined as rentals of fewer than 30 days—are permitted as a business activity in Loudon, provided you obtain and maintain a local business license and comply with Tennessee’s state-level business (gross receipts) tax. Loudon also imposes a 4% hotel/motel occupancy tax on STRs and requires monthly filing and remittance. There is no separate city-issued STR permit or zoning clearance identified in the provided materials; however, building, fire, and property maintenance codes still apply.
Important: If your property is in a homeowners’ association (HOA) or property owners association (POA), recorded covenants (CC&Rs) may impose stricter limits—such as minimum lease terms (e.g., 30+ days or 1 year), short-term rental prohibitions, owner-occupancy requirements, or rental caps. In Loudon and throughout Tennessee, recorded HOA covenants are generally enforceable; therefore, you must check and comply with both HOA rules and city/state requirements.

Loudon is a city in and the county seat of Loudon County, Tennessee, United States. Its population was 6,001 at the 2020 census. It is included in the Knoxville, Tennessee Metropolitan Statistical Area. The city is located in East Tennessee, southwest of Knoxville, on the Tennessee River. Fort Loudoun, the colonial era fort for which the city was named, is located several miles to the south in Monroe County.
